ServiceNow HR Service Delivery centers on HR request intake, assignment, approvals, and fulfillment using Service Catalog, Service Request items, and Case records. Automation rules and scripted actions run inside the workflow designer to standardize onboarding, offboarding, document collection, and request routing. Integration is handled through platform APIs and eventing patterns that connect to systems like HRIS, identity providers, and email workflows. Admins can enforce RBAC, workflow approvals, and audit history to support controlled HR operations at scale.

A tradeoff is that HR teams usually need ServiceNow platform configuration work to match existing HR process variations and case taxonomies. A strong usage situation is multi-department HR operations that need one workflow and automation layer for intake, compliance checks, and fulfillment steps.

BambooHR is a fit for HR support that starts with employee data quality and funnels requests through repeatable workflows. The onboarding and offboarding checklists include assignable tasks and due dates, and the platform can capture approvals and signatures on HR forms. Employee self-service reduces HR back-and-forth for standard HR changes, and manager self-service helps teams initiate and track common requests.

A tradeoff appears when organizations need service-desk-style SLAs, multi-channel communications, and complex agent workflows. BambooHR works best when HR support is primarily HR operations work like account changes, document collection, and lifecycle checklists. Teams that require deep IT ticketing, routing rules, and granular support analytics usually need a dedicated support system alongside it.

UKG HR Service Delivery centers on HR case management with configurable workflows that map requests to the right resolver groups and stages. Employee self-service portals and manager self-service entry points feed cases, while HR agents use guided steps to request missing information and complete outcomes. Document attachments, status updates, and task ownership are designed for a mixed queue environment where HR requests require more than free-form chat.

A tradeoff is that the workflow configuration and governance model requires careful setup across departments so routing stays accurate as request types grow. It fits teams that already operate with UKG HR records and want HR case workflows to follow consistent steps for onboarding, policy changes, and employee data corrections.

HiBob combines HR case support with an HRIS-style employee data backbone, so HR workflows can reference the same records used across lifecycle tasks. The system supports HR self-service and manager-facing request flows, which reduces back-and-forth when employees need document updates or policy questions.

HiBob also provides role-based access controls and an audit trail for changes, which supports internal governance for HR operations. Integrations and API access support provisioning and workflow connectivity with IT identity systems and business apps.

Freshservice for HR routes employee questions and requests through HR helpdesk workflows with ticket categories, approvals, and SLA targets. It supports onboarding and offboarding task checklists, document collection, and HR case collaboration that keeps managers and HR agents on the same record.

HR teams can automate request intake by mapping forms to ticket fields and triggering actions through built-in automation rules. Reporting is focused on HR service performance, ticket aging, and workflow bottlenecks rather than on HR transactions.

Zoho People fits HR teams that want HR support workflows inside an employee self-service portal and a case-driven helpdesk experience. It covers core HR modules like employee profiles, attendance support, leave management, and HR document management, plus manager and employee request flows.

Zoho People also integrates with the broader Zoho identity and service stack so SSO, role-based access, and HR request routing can be configured across systems. Automation is handled through workflow rules that trigger notifications and approvals based on HR events tied to employee records.

Darwinbox combines HR case management, employee self-service, and manager workflows inside one HR support experience. The solution focuses on structured HR processes like onboarding, offboarding, and policy-driven request handling tied to employee records.

Role-based configuration controls who can resolve cases, view sensitive data, and approve workflow steps. Admin tooling supports integration-led deployments through provisioning, SSO, and API-driven extensions.

Common pitfalls when implementing HR support software

Many failures come from workflow design choices that do not reflect how HR cases actually move through approvals and fulfillment. Several tools are workflow-driven, so configuration governance decides whether outcomes stay consistent.

Reporting mistakes also show up when teams expect out-of-the-box metrics without validating tagging, categorization, and data extraction patterns used by each product.

  • Treating workflow configuration as a one-time setup instead of a governance process

    ServiceNow HR Service Delivery and UKG HR Service Delivery both depend on the workflow and routing design effort, so teams should plan ownership for workflow changes. Allocate governance time for process coverage and guided step consistency to prevent workflow drift.

  • Assuming a lifecycle checklist tool can replace full HR ticketing

    BambooHR does not replace full-feature HR service desk ticketing, so intake handling beyond checklists can require a broader service desk approach. Freshservice for HR and Jira Service Management patterns are better aligned when case ticketing is the core workflow.

  • Letting HR forms and field mappings evolve without controls

    Freshservice for HR and Zoho People both can require careful governance around complex HR forms and field mappings to keep automation correct. Establish a controlled change process for tags, categories, and workflow rules tied to employee records.

  • Expecting advanced HR KPI reporting without planning for data shaping

    ServiceNow HR Service Delivery may require custom data modeling and views for HR KPI reporting, especially when reporting needs span workflow steps and case states. Zoho People can require exports for deeper HR service metrics, so metrics planning should happen during implementation.
